I have found that good ol' Windex (or similar product) works quite nicely. I have used Shiela Shine (used by hospitals to polish their SS sinks), and was not impressed. It, too, left the car a bit oily to touch- though it looked nice & shiny. Drive Stainless Robert VIN 6924
